Как работает Session App Public-Key-Based Auth? И как применить его в приложении Django?

Я хочу реализовать этот метод аутентификации в приложении Django. Как это работает? И как его реализовать?

Обычно ожидаемый пользовательский опыт восстановления учетной записи с помощью имени пользователя и пароля невозможно. Вместо этого пользователям предлагается записать свой долгосрочный закрытый ключ (представленный как мнемонического семени, называемого в рамках Session фразой восстановления) при при создании учетной записи. Пользователь может использовать этот резервный ключ для восстановления своего аккаунта в случае потери или уничтожения устройства, а контакты пользователя смогут продолжать связываться с той же учетной записью пользователя, а не чем заново устанавливать контакт с новым ключом.

.

https://getsession.org/faq

Вернуться на верх